I found a Jeep that Crown had for sale that was priced at $52,000. I made an appointment to come see it and talk about buying it. When I got there, the sales rep said he didn't know where the Jeep was but he got the key and started clicking it to find it. I did hear a beep signal from a car somewhere in the lot, but he said it's not here, then said it had been sold the day before. Then couple sales people tried to get me interested in a different Jeep that wasn't what I wanted and much more expensive. I had been through this bait and switch treatment before, so I decided to leave. Before I got to my car they stopped me and asked if I could wait for the car i wanted to be delivered here. I said yes, and we went to talk about a deal. I was told they could find my Jeep, which they did, but it was going to cost more. I was told that the reason the other was cheaper was it was one that had been returned. I was talked out of buying, and into leasing a Jeep. The selling point being they would give me a good price for my trade in, and buy it outright. I was also told that I would get the $7,500 rebate up front instead off my taxes, and I was told the interest rates were high now. So, on with the deal, there was some fast talking and lots of confusing jargon. I finally agreed to the lease and a more expensive car, assuming it would be superior to the one i came for. I wasn't able to see the car i was leasing until the following Monday. When I got there, my Jeep was there, but it was pretty much standard and didn't have any extras, I noticed it didn't even have running boards, which I think should be standard. Then I looked at the Sticker price and it was $55,000, the price i was given was $67,000. I assumed that the higher price was because this would have all the "bells and whistles", this one did not. I asked how it went fro 55 to 67? He didn't know, and the manager wasn't there that i had dealt with, I was told it was explained to me and it would be on my paperwork. I looked at the paperwork, and it didnt' really explain what had happened. Basically, my rebate/discount of $10,000 was taken off after $12,000 was added on. So, I have buyer's remorse, and I feel I made a mistake. I should have acted on my first impulse, and left when they didn't have the car i wanted at the price i wanted. I regret that I didn't ask more questions, and refused to sign until I understood exactly what I was signing. It took ten minutes to make the handshake deal, then I waited in an office for four hours, again, I should have left. By the time I was signing papers, I was desperate to get out of there, and quickly signed what was put before me. If I had to do it all over, I would not have signed a lease at that price, but I'm stuck with it, and I have to live with it for three years. I'm not happy with my experience, More
